160.05 160.05(1) (1) Identification. Each regulatory agency shall submit to the department a list of those substances which are related to facilities, activities and practices within its authority to regulate and which are detected in or have a reasonable probability of entering the groundwater resources of the state. 160.05(2) (2) Petition. 160.05(2)(a) (a) Any person may petition a regulatory agency to add a substance to or delete a substance from the list submitted to the department under sub.
